You are responsible somehow for a curse that befalls 12 unfortunate hawt dudes. Now you have to find them and break the curse with your love!!

    Pros

    • Cute and diverse characters
    • Engaging idle gameplay
    • Inclusive lgbtq+ themes
    • Frequent updates and events
    • Free to play with optional dlc

    Cons

    • Tedious and repetitive clicking
    • Slow progression without spending
    • Paywalls and microtransactions
    • Limited story depth
    • Some players find grind frustrating

    Motivations

    • Autonomy
      3

      "Players have freedom to choose which characters to pursue and how to allocate time slots, but progression is gated by game mechanics and resets."

    • Competence
      1

      "Game involves some skill in managing resources and timing resets, but largely repetitive clicking and grinding with predictable outcomes."

    • Competition
      -4

      "Focus is on personal progress and pacing; no evidence of player-vs-player or leaderboard competition."

    • Continuation
      5

      "Highly addictive with many players reporting long-term habitual play and repeated sessions over months or years."

    • Cooperation
      -5

      "Single-player idle dating sim with no cooperative or multiplayer elements."

    • Creativity
      1

      "Some customization in character relationships and cosmetic unlocks, but core gameplay follows predefined clicker mechanics."

    • Domination
      -5

      "No social dominance or power over others; interactions are personal and non-competitive."

    • Escapism
      5

      "Players use the game as a stress relief and distraction, enjoying fantasy romance and cute characters."

    • Expectation
      -4

      "Players engage voluntarily out of personal interest and enjoyment, not obligation or external pressure."

    • Experimenting
      -2

      "Gameplay is mostly repetitive with limited novelty; some players experiment with strategies but overall routine."

    • Exploration
      -3

      "Limited exploration; game mostly involves progressing through known content and repeating tasks."

    • Expression
      2

      "Some avatar and character customization through outfits and DLC, allowing personal expression."

    • Fantasy
      5

      "Strong fantasy elements with anthropomorphic characters, romantic fiction, and imaginative scenarios."

    • Fellowship
      -5

      "No community or social group identity; primarily solo play."

    • Growth
      2

      "Players develop skills in resource management and progress characters, but learning curve is mild."

    • Health
      -5

      "Sedentary gameplay with extensive clicking; no physical activity involved."

    • Idle
      5

      "Designed as an idle game with offline progress and daily check-ins; supports casual intermittent play."

    • Intimacy
      3

      "Players form emotional connections with characters through dialogue and relationship progression."

    • Leadership
      -5

      "No leadership or group management roles; purely individual gameplay."

    • Progression
      5

      "Strong emphasis on accumulating items, upgrades, and character relationship levels."

    • Relaxation
      3

      "Many players find the game relaxing and a way to unwind, though some find it tedious or grindy."

    • Sensation
      3

      "Enjoyable visual and auditory elements including character art and voice acting enhance sensory appeal."

    • Status
      -5

      "No social recognition or status systems; achievements are personal and not publicly ranked."

    • Story
      2

      "Contains light narrative and character stories that engage players, though not deeply immersive."

    • Strategy
      1

      "Some planning in resource allocation and reset timing, but overall straightforward gameplay."

    • Thrill
      -3

      "Low risk and suspense; gameplay is predictable and lacks tension or excitement."

    • Value
      1

      "Free-to-play with optional purchases; some players feel value is good, others note grind and paywalls."

    • Violence
      -5

      "No combat or destructive gameplay; focus on building relationships and collecting items."

    • Survival
      -5

      "No survival elements or threats; stable and safe game environment."
